    Have you ever heard of the saying that money can't buy you happiness? Well, in this case, there is an exception. The gift of sight again is amazing and truly mind-blowing. I had been thinking about lasik eye surgery for years, but recently just started really looking into it. A friend got hers done at Millennium 2 years ago and still talks highly of the doctor. I decided to give it a shot and filled out the Online Consultation form. I didn't hear back for a week so I followed up. Brittany was able to squeeze me in for an appt on 6/29. She emailed me a Patient Form to fill out to bring to the appt. At the office, I signed in and gave the receptionist my ID and Form. My friend and I enjoyed free snacks/beverages from the kitchen. Later, Ann started some tests, asked a few questions about my medical history, and then Dr. Breault did some tests as well. She answered some of my questions and concerns, and provided me with a lubricant drop sample for my dry eyes. Ann came back and told me about the cost and finance options. It was expensive but from the research I had done, this place is legit and highly recommended. They only do surgeries one day a week. I was told that since I have myopia and astigmatism (and I have small eyes), it may be a bit tough to open my eyes, but Dr. Lessner will figure out how because lasik is his specialty. I wasn't sure if I could afford the surgery, but scheduled the appts anyways. Ann gave me a folder with the center's info and the price sheet. Days later, I received a call about a form of payment of $200? for the Pre Op exam. I was confused. I was told that it's not an additional charge--it's part of the procedure cost. So then I canceled the appts because that would have been $ out the door if I decide not to go with them. I waited until I went to another place for the 2nd appt to make my final decision. After that appt on 7/11, I decided that Millennium was THE ONE. However I was still concerned about the cost so I called the next day. Brittany/Kelly were able to work with me and told me that there was no rush to decide. An hour later, I called back about my decision. I was scheduled for Pre Op on 7/13 and surgery on 7/15. That night, I watched videos on their website havelasik.com and YouTube of previous patients' surgeries and experiences. At Pre Op, I sat down with Kelly, took care of my payment. Then one of the staff members did some tests and Dr. Breault proceeded with more tests. She dilated my eyes, checked my eyes' health, and prescribed eye drops that I needed to use starting that day to prepare for the surgery. Since I don't have insurance, Dr. Breault went out of her way to help me find coupons online for generic version, which was cheaper. I went to Walmart Pharmacy nearby and got the antibiotic drop. 7/15: A friend drove me to the office for the procedure 3:30pm. A staff checked my vision, asked if I think I would need Xanax, I said no, she took my Consent Forms, and then Dr. Breault checked my eyes again. There was some down time while Dr. Lessner was working on a group of patients. I peeked at some of the surgeries. Ann prepped me, wiped my eyes, and put in numbing drops. I was called into an office and Dr. Lessner introduced himself. He checked my visions again, marked my left eye where the astigmatism was, and informed me that they might have to use another machine for creating the flap but that it's just as good. He also asked me if I have anyone who planned to watch the procedure live because he can do a little shout-out. When it was my turn for the surgery 6pm, I got so nervous. The staff helped me lay down on the bed seat and Dr. Lessner explained what he was going to do. During the procedure, I was given the Panther plushy to hold onto. Dr. Lessner proceeded with the procedure. For my right eye, they had to use the other machine in another room across to create the flap. Ann held my hands because I was so nervous. The rest is just like a "laser show." After both eyes were done, the staff and Dr. Lessner helped me get up. I was balling and couldn't stop crying because I saw the clock that everyone was talking about. Dr. Lessner said that he's never seen anyone so happy to see a clock. I laughed because he's right. I could see the numbers and little lines. We posed for a picture. I looked crazy but was so ecstatic about the results. I was mind blown about being able to see right away. I was given a pair of sunglasses. After the staff finished with the rest of the patients, Dr. Lessner re-checked our visions. Then I was given a blue pouch with some drops and instructions of post care. My eyes had discomfort for a while but the numbing drops helped. By 1am, my eyes felt better. Next day, I went back for follow up and Dr. B. said I have 20/20 vision. Even though Millennium was way farther from where I live and more expensive, it was worth every penny. I am truly very thankful for the procedure, the technology, the staff, and being able to see again.
